 If the athlete qualified through continental qualification, the quota place will be reallocated to the next best ranked athlete of that continent according to the Continental Ranking List regardless of the athlete’s weight category, while respecting the following principles:.
 Maximum one (1) athlete per NOC can qualify through continental qualification across all weight categories and genders.
 Maximum two (2) athletes per weight category per continent can qualify through continental qualification.
 Gender quotas must be respected in each continent, as per the table in D. Qualification Places.
 If a continent fails to use its full allocation, any remaining quota place will be reallocated according to the IJF World Ranking List of 30 May 2016 to the highest ranked athlete, not yet qualified, in the respective gender, respecting the maximum quota of one (1) athlete per NOC per event.

Any surprises? 100kg name looks new?

 

Yes. Luciano Correa was our number 1 athlete for years in the -100kg class, being world champion once and also having won the last two Pan American Games. He was going for his third Olympics but didn't achieve great results this season - being surpassed by Rafael Buzacarini in the rankings. While the ranking was not the only criteria for the selection (Kitadai was chosen over a better ranked athlete), Buzacarani is clearly better at the moment.

The only sorta surprise i see is at 60, Eric Takabatke finished the ranking period with more points then Kitadai

 

Yes, Takabatake finished the ranking period ahead of Kitadai, but barely. While the ranking has certainly played a major role in the selection, other factors were considered. For instance, Kitadai has a much better history against top 12 athletes, and also is a current Olympic medalist.
